Cybersecurity penetration testing has become an essential component of modern IT security strategies for businesses in San Diego. As cyber threats continue to evolve in sophistication, organizations must proactively identify and address vulnerabilities before malicious actors can exploit them. Penetration testing, often called “pen testing,” involves authorized simulated attacks on computer systems, networks, and applications to evaluate their security posture. For San Diego businesses, where technology sectors are thriving alongside defense contractors and biotech firms, robust security testing is particularly crucial given the sensitive nature of the data these industries protect.
San Diego’s unique business landscape—combining military, biotech, telecommunications, and startup ecosystems—creates specific cybersecurity challenges that penetration testing services can address. Local regulations, California’s strict data privacy laws, and industry-specific compliance requirements further emphasize the need for comprehensive security assessments. When properly implemented, penetration testing helps organizations identify weaknesses, validate security controls, and demonstrate due diligence in protecting sensitive information. As cybersecurity threats increase in frequency and impact, many San Diego businesses are incorporating regular penetration testing into their strategic planning processes.
Types of Penetration Testing Services Available in San Diego
San Diego cybersecurity firms offer various types of penetration testing services, each designed to assess different aspects of an organization’s security infrastructure. Understanding these different approaches helps businesses select the most appropriate testing methodology based on their specific security concerns, compliance requirements, and business objectives. Organizations should consider scheduling different types of tests throughout the year as part of their continuous improvement process.
- Network Penetration Testing: Evaluates the security of internal and external network infrastructure by identifying exploitable vulnerabilities in servers, firewalls, routers, and other network devices that San Diego businesses rely on for daily operations.
- Web Application Testing: Assesses web applications for security flaws, including OWASP Top 10 vulnerabilities like injection attacks, broken authentication, and cross-site scripting that could compromise sensitive customer data.
- Mobile Application Testing: Examines vulnerabilities in iOS and Android applications, which is particularly relevant for San Diego’s growing mobile development sector and startup ecosystem.
- Wireless Network Testing: Identifies security weaknesses in Wi-Fi networks, which is crucial for maintaining secure operations in San Diego’s collaborative workspaces and technology hubs.
- Social Engineering Testing: Evaluates human vulnerabilities through phishing simulations, pretexting, and physical security assessments to test employee awareness and team communication protocols.
Each type of penetration test requires different skill sets and tools, so many San Diego organizations work with specialized providers or firms that offer comprehensive security assessment services. Modern penetration testing services often integrate with an organization’s existing workforce management technology to ensure testing activities don’t disrupt critical business operations.
The Penetration Testing Process for San Diego Businesses
Understanding the penetration testing process helps San Diego businesses prepare effectively and maximize the value of their security assessments. A structured approach ensures thorough coverage of all potential vulnerabilities while minimizing disruption to normal business operations. Establishing clear communication protocols between your team and the penetration testers is essential for a successful engagement.
- Planning and Scoping: Define test objectives, scope, and constraints, including which systems will be tested and which testing methods will be used, with clear timelines and notification procedures.
- Reconnaissance and Information Gathering: Collect information about target systems using both passive and active techniques to identify potential entry points and vulnerabilities.
- Vulnerability Scanning and Analysis: Deploy automated tools to identify known vulnerabilities in systems, networks, and applications, followed by manual verification to eliminate false positives.
- Active Exploitation: Attempt to exploit discovered vulnerabilities to gain unauthorized access to systems, escalate privileges, or extract sensitive data—always within the agreed-upon scope.
- Post-Exploitation Analysis: Determine the potential business impact of successful exploits, including potential data breaches, operational disruptions, or compliance violations specific to San Diego and California regulations.
- Reporting and Remediation Guidance: Document findings, including vulnerability details, exploitation methods, potential impacts, and prioritized remediation recommendations tailored to your organization’s risk profile.
Effective penetration testing requires careful scheduling to ensure adequate resources are available both for conducting the tests and addressing any critical vulnerabilities that may be discovered. Many San Diego organizations leverage specialized scheduling software to coordinate these complex security initiatives across departments.
Regulatory Compliance and Penetration Testing in San Diego
San Diego businesses operate under various regulatory frameworks that either require or strongly recommend regular penetration testing. Understanding these requirements is crucial for maintaining compliance and avoiding potential penalties. Beyond meeting regulatory obligations, penetration testing demonstrates a commitment to security that can enhance customer trust and business reputation throughout Southern California.
- California Consumer Privacy Act (CCPA): While not explicitly requiring penetration testing, the CCPA mandates reasonable security measures for consumer data protection, with penalties up to $7,500 per intentional violation.
- Health Insurance Portability and Accountability Act (HIPAA): Requires regular risk assessments, including technical evaluations like penetration testing, particularly relevant for San Diego’s significant healthcare and biotech sectors.
- Payment Card Industry Data Security Standard (PCI DSS): Mandates annual penetration testing for merchants and service providers handling credit card data, affecting numerous San Diego retail and hospitality businesses.
- Defense Federal Acquisition Regulation Supplement (DFARS): Requires security assessments for contractors working with the Department of Defense, a significant consideration for San Diego’s large defense industry presence.
- Sarbanes-Oxley Act (SOX): While not explicitly requiring penetration testing, SOX compliance for publicly traded companies includes demonstrating effective IT controls, which penetration testing can support.
Maintaining compliance with these regulations requires careful scheduling and workflow automation to ensure testing activities are conducted at the required intervals. Many San Diego organizations implement automated scheduling systems to manage these compliance activities alongside their regular security operations.
Benefits of Regular Penetration Testing for San Diego Organizations
Regular penetration testing provides numerous advantages beyond simply identifying vulnerabilities. For San Diego businesses operating in competitive industries like technology, biotech, and defense, these benefits can translate into significant competitive advantages, improved operational efficiency, and enhanced customer trust. Understanding these benefits helps organizations justify the investment in comprehensive security testing programs.
- Identify Security Weaknesses: Discover vulnerabilities before malicious actors do, allowing for proactive remediation and risk reduction across your technology infrastructure.
- Validate Security Controls: Verify that existing security measures are functioning effectively against current threat landscapes that target San Diego businesses.
- Regulatory Compliance: Meet requirements for various regulations and standards applicable to San Diego businesses, including CCPA, HIPAA, PCI DSS, and industry-specific frameworks.
- Reduce Security Incident Costs: Minimize the financial impact of potential breaches by addressing vulnerabilities before they can be exploited, with data breaches averaging $4.35 million in costs according to recent studies.
- Enhance Security Awareness: Improve organizational understanding of security risks and foster a stronger security culture among employees through lessons learned from testing.
To maximize these benefits, many San Diego organizations are integrating penetration testing into their broader security programs and continuous improvement methodologies. Effective coordination of testing activities requires robust team communication tools and processes to ensure all stakeholders are properly informed and engaged.
Choosing the Right Penetration Testing Provider in San Diego
Selecting the right penetration testing provider is crucial for obtaining valuable, actionable results. San Diego businesses should consider several factors when evaluating potential security partners. The right provider will not only identify vulnerabilities but also help prioritize remediation efforts based on your specific business context and risk profile. Establishing clear expectations and deliverables before engaging a provider helps ensure the testing process aligns with your security goals.
- Technical Expertise and Certifications: Look for providers with relevant certifications like OSCP, CEH, GPEN, or CREST, and experience with your specific industry and technology stack.
- Methodology and Approach: Evaluate their testing methodology, including whether they use a combination of automated tools and manual techniques for comprehensive coverage.
- Local San Diego Presence: Consider providers with local presence who understand the specific threat landscape and regulatory environment of Southern California businesses.
- Reporting Quality: Assess sample reports to ensure they provide clear, actionable findings with appropriate technical details and business-focused remediation recommendations.
- References and Case Studies: Request references from similar San Diego organizations to verify the provider’s track record of delivering valuable penetration testing services.
Coordinating with penetration testing providers requires effective scheduling systems to ensure testing activities occur at optimal times with minimal business disruption. Many San Diego organizations use specialized scheduling strategies to coordinate security activities across departments and with external vendors.
Preparing for a Penetration Test: Best Practices for San Diego Businesses
Thorough preparation is essential for a successful penetration test that delivers maximum value with minimal disruption. San Diego businesses should take several steps before testing begins to ensure a smooth process and meaningful results. Proper preparation also helps avoid common pitfalls such as unexpected system outages or operational disruptions during testing activities.
- Define Clear Objectives: Establish specific goals for the penetration test, such as evaluating specific systems, addressing compliance requirements, or validating new security controls.
- Document Test Scope: Clearly define which systems are in-scope and out-of-scope, including IP ranges, domains, applications, and specific testing techniques that are permitted or prohibited.
- Establish Communication Channels: Create emergency contact procedures and regular update mechanisms between your team and the testing provider during the assessment period.
- Prepare Your Team: Notify relevant stakeholders about the testing schedule, especially IT and security teams who may need to monitor systems during testing.
- Back Up Critical Systems: Ensure recent backups are available for all systems being tested, even though professional testers take precautions to avoid disruption.
Effective preparation requires coordinated resource allocation and clear communication strategies across teams. Many San Diego organizations use employee scheduling tools to ensure the right personnel are available during critical testing activities.
Understanding Penetration Testing Reports and Findings
Interpreting penetration testing reports is crucial for translating technical findings into effective security improvements. A well-structured report provides both technical details for remediation teams and business context for executive decision-makers. Learning to analyze these reports helps San Diego organizations prioritize their security investments and focus on addressing the most critical vulnerabilities first.
- Executive Summary: Provides a high-level overview of key findings, risk levels, and broad recommendations suitable for management and non-technical stakeholders.
- Methodology Description: Details the testing approach, tools used, and techniques employed to establish the thoroughness and validity of the assessment.
- Vulnerability Findings: Lists discovered vulnerabilities with technical details, including severity ratings, exploitation methods, and potential business impacts.
- Proof of Concept Evidence: Provides screenshots, code snippets, or other evidence demonstrating successful exploitation to validate findings and understand attack paths.
- Remediation Recommendations: Offers specific, actionable guidance for addressing each vulnerability, often with short-term mitigations and long-term solutions.
Effectively responding to penetration test findings requires proper task tracking systems and clear team communication principles to ensure vulnerabilities are addressed in a timely manner. Many San Diego organizations implement dedicated workflow automation processes for managing security remediation activities.
Implementing Effective Remediation Strategies
After receiving penetration testing results, developing and implementing an effective remediation strategy is critical for improving your security posture. This process involves prioritizing vulnerabilities, assigning resources, and verifying that remediation efforts are successful. A systematic approach ensures that the most critical security issues are addressed promptly while managing overall security improvement within budget constraints.
- Risk-Based Prioritization: Categorize vulnerabilities based on severity, exploitation difficulty, and potential business impact to focus on the most critical issues first.
- Remediation Planning: Develop specific action plans for each vulnerability, including required resources, responsible parties, and completion timeframes.
- Implementation Tracking: Use project management or ticketing systems to track remediation progress, ensuring accountability and preventing issues from being overlooked.
- Verification Testing: Conduct follow-up testing to confirm that vulnerabilities have been properly addressed and new security controls are functioning effectively.
- Long-Term Security Improvements: Incorporate lessons learned into security policies, procedures, and training programs to prevent similar vulnerabilities in the future.
Coordinating remediation activities across teams requires effective resource allocation and project management tool integration. Many San Diego organizations leverage marketplace solutions to efficiently allocate specialized security resources during intensive remediation periods.
Cost Considerations for Penetration Testing in San Diego
Understanding the cost factors associated with penetration testing helps San Diego businesses budget appropriately and ensure they receive good value for their security investment. Pricing varies significantly based on several factors, and organizations should consider both direct costs and the potential return on investment when planning for security assessments. Comparing multiple providers can help ensure competitive pricing without sacrificing quality.
- Scope and Complexity: Testing costs increase with the number of systems, applications, and network components included in the assessment scope, ranging from $4,000 for basic tests to $100,000+ for comprehensive enterprise assessments.
- Testing Methodology: Different testing approaches (black box, gray box, white box) have varying costs based on the level of information provided and testing depth required.
- Provider Expertise: Highly specialized or certified security professionals typically command higher rates, though their expertise may deliver more valuable insights.
- Testing Frequency: Regular testing programs (quarterly, bi-annual, or annual) may qualify for package pricing that reduces the per-test cost.
- Additional Services: Remediation support, follow-up testing, and security program development services add to the base testing costs but may provide greater overall value.
Effective budgeting for security testing requires careful cost management and strategic resource allocation optimization. Many San Diego organizations implement scheduling optimization metrics to maximize the value of their security testing investments.
Building a Continuous Security Testing Program
Rather than treating penetration testing as a one-time project, forward-thinking San Diego organizations are implementing continuous security testing programs that integrate with their overall security strategy. This approach provides ongoing visibility into security posture and helps maintain resilience against evolving threats. A mature security program incorporates different types of assessments throughout the year to provide comprehensive coverage.
- Define Testing Cadence: Establish regular testing schedules based on risk levels, system changes, and compliance requirements, typically including annual comprehensive tests and quarterly focused assessments.
- Integrate with Development Lifecycle: Incorporate security testing into your software development and system deployment processes to identify vulnerabilities before production release.
- Combine Testing Methods: Use a mix of vulnerability scanning, penetration testing, and red team exercises to provide different perspectives on your security posture.
- Track Security Metrics: Establish KPIs to measure security improvement over time, such as vulnerability remediation rates, average time to fix, and reduction in critical findings.
- Foster Security Culture: Use testing results as learning opportunities to improve security awareness and practices across the organization.
Implementing continuous security testing requires effective scheduling tools and time tracking systems to coordinate activities across teams and track progress toward security goals. Many San Diego organizations use optimization algorithms to balance security testing resources with other business priorities.
Conclusion: Maximizing the Value of Penetration Testing
Penetration testing represents a critical investment in your organization’s security posture and risk management strategy. For San Diego businesses operating in competitive and highly regulated industries, these assessments provide valuable insights that drive concrete security improvements and demonstrate due diligence to customers, partners, and regulators. By selecting qualified providers, preparing thoroughly, and implementing a structured remediation process, organizations can maximize the return on their penetration testing investment.
To get the most value from penetration testing, integrate it into your broader security program rather than treating it as a compliance checkbox. Use findings to drive continuous improvement in security controls, processes, and awareness. Develop a culture where security testing is viewed as a positive tool for improvement rather than a punitive exercise. With cybersecurity threats constantly evolving, regular penetration testing helps San Diego organizations stay ahead of potential attackers and protect their most valuable digital assets.
FAQ
1. How often should San Diego businesses conduct penetration testing?
The frequency of penetration testing depends on several factors including your industry, regulatory requirements, and risk profile. Most San Diego organizations should conduct comprehensive penetration tests at least annually, with additional testing after significant system changes or infrastructure updates. Businesses in highly regulated industries like healthcare, finance, or those working with government contracts may need more frequent testing, sometimes quarterly. Organizations with active development cycles should consider integrating security testing into their release process to identify vulnerabilities before production deployment. Remember that different systems may require different testing cadences based on their criticality and exposure.
2. What’s the difference between vulnerability scanning and penetration testing?
While often confused, vulnerability scanning and penetration testing are distinct security assessment approaches. Vulnerability scanning uses automated tools to identify known vulnerabilities in systems and applications, providing a broad overview of potential security issues. These scans are relatively quick, inexpensive, and can be run frequently. In contrast, penetration testing combines automated tools with manual techniques performed by security professionals who attempt to exploit vulnerabilities to gain unauthorized access. Penetration testing provides deeper insights into how vulnerabilities could be chained together in real attacks, verifies whether vulnerabilities are exploitable in your specific environment, and assesses the potential business impact. Most effective security programs use both approaches: regular vulnerability scanning for continuous monitoring and periodic penetration testing for in-depth security validation.
3. How should we prepare our staff for a penetration test?
Proper staff preparation is crucial for a successful penetration test. First, ensure key stakeholders understand the test’s purpose, scope, and timeline. For technical teams, provide information about testing windows and emergency contact procedures in case critical systems are affected. If social engineering is part of the scope, decide whether employees should be informed about potential phishing attempts or other social engineering tactics—some organizations prefer to test without warning to assess realistic responses, while others notify employees to avoid disruption. Create a clear escalation path for any concerns during testing, and emphasize that the assessment aims to improve security rather than assign blame for vulnerabilities. Finally, prepare your remediation teams to respond quickly to any critical issues discovered during testing, especially if the test includes real-time reporting of severe vulnerabilities.
4. What certifications should we look for when hiring a penetration testing provider in San Diego?
When evaluating penetration testing providers in San Diego, look for professionals with industry-recognized certifications that demonstrate technical expertise and ethical testing practices. Top certifications include Offensive Security Certified Professional (OSCP), which validates hands-on penetration testing skills; Certified Ethical Hacker (CEH), which covers ethical hacking methodologies; GIAC Penetration Tester (GPEN), which demonstrates advanced penetration testing abilities; and Certified Information Systems Security Professional (CISSP), which indicates broader security knowledge. For organizations with specific compliance requirements, consider providers with specialized certifications like PCI Qualified Security Assessor (QSA) for payment card environments or CREST certification for formal penetration testing frameworks. Beyond individual certifications, evaluate the firm’s overall reputation in the San Diego cybersecurity community, years of experience, and references from similar organizations in your industry.
5. How do we determine the appropriate scope for our penetration test?
Determining the right scope for your penetration test requires balancing comprehensive coverage with practical constraints. Start by identifying your most critical assets—systems that process sensitive data or support essential business functions—as these should be prioritized. Consider regulatory requirements that may mandate testing for specific systems, such as those handling payment card data or protected health information. Evaluate recent changes to your environment, as new systems or significant updates often introduce vulnerabilities. Define clear boundaries for testing, including specific IP ranges, applications, and domains, while explicitly noting any systems that should be excluded due to fragility or business criticality. Finally, consider your budget and timeline constraints, potentially adopting a phased approach that rotates through different segments of your environment over time. Working with an experienced penetration testing provider can help you define an appropriate scope that maximizes value while managing risks and resources effectively.